Changing the Playback Settings

Reducing noise in the playback sound and making the human voice
clearer – the noise cut function
When the noise cut function is effective in the playback mode, ambient noise
other than the human voice is reduced. A file is played back with clear sound
quality because the noise of all frequency bands including a human voice is
reduced.
To set the noise cut level
In the stop or playback mode, press and hold
MENU/NOISE CUT for approximately 2 seconds or
longer.
The "Noise Cut" setting window will be displayed.
Press  or  to select "Maximum" or "Medium," and then press /
ENT.
Press  STOP to exit the menu mode.
To cancel the noise cut function
Set "Noise Cut" to "OFF" in step .
